摘 要:目的:探讨清热解毒中药黄芩、栀子等有效组分配伍而成的注射液(TLQN注射液)对内毒素(LPS)所致大鼠感染性脑水肿的脑保护作用及其可能机制。方法:70只SD大鼠随机分为正常组、模型组、清开灵组(3 mL/kg)、地塞米松组(10 mg/kg)、TLQN注射液低、中、高剂量组(24、47.5、95 mg/kg)。经颈内动脉注射LPS(1 mg/kg)建立感染性脑损伤模型,各给药组在注入LPS后立即尾静脉注射相应药物。造模前以及造模6h后各测量一次体温。取各组脑组织标本,干湿法测定脑组织含水量,甲酰胺法检测脑组织伊文思蓝(EB)水平,HE染色后观察各组脑组织病理形态变化,酶联免疫法(ELISA)检测各组血清TNF-α、IL-6含量。结果:模型组体温、脑组织含水量和EB含量明显高于正常组(P<0.01),皮质及海马区存在广泛的神经元、胶质细胞损伤,血清TNF-α及IL-6水平显著升高(P<0.01);TLQN注射液可明显降低模型大鼠体温(P<0.05),减少脑组织含水量及EB含量(P<0.05,0.01),改善脑组织神经元、胶质细胞损伤,显著降低血清TNF-α和IL-6水平(P<0.05)。结论:清热解毒中药有效组分配伍对LPS致大鼠感染性脑损伤有保护作用,其机制可能与抑制TNF-α和IL-6等细胞因子过度产生有关。Objective: To explore the protective effect of Heat- Clearing antitoxicant herb( Scutellaria baicalensis Georgi,Gardenia jasminoides Ellis,et al) component compatibility( TLQN Injection) on infectious brain edema in rats induced by lipopolysaccharide( LPS) and its possible therapeutic mechanism. Methods: A total of 70 SD rats were divided randomly into model group,control group,Qingkailing group( 3 mL / kg),Dexamethasone group( 10 mg / kg),TLQN low-dose( 24 mg / kg),middle-dose( 47. 5 mg / kg) and highdose( 95 mg / kg) group. Models of acute infectious brain edema of rats were prepared by injecting LPS( 1 mg / kg) via left internal carotid artery,and the drugs was injected at the same time as LPS was given via tail vein. 6h after the models were established,the body temperature,the water content and EB content in the brain was measured,the pathological changes was observed and the serum TNF-α、IL-6 was mesured by ELISA. Results: The body temperature,the water content and EB content in the brain were higher in model group than in control group,as well as injured cortical and hippocampacal neurons and glial cells,the serum TNF-α and IL-6 levels in model group were higher than control group; TLQN injection can significantly decrease the body temperature,reduce water content and EB content,improve injured neurons and glial cells,and decrease the serum TNF-α and IL-6 levels. Conclusion: The Heat-Clearing antitoxicant herb component compatibility injection may lighten the degree of infectious brain injury induced by LPS,the possible mechanism could be it can inhibit the overproduction of cytokines such as TNF-α and IL-6.
